Basic Concepts of Flywheel Housing

A flywheel housing encases the flywheel, a heavy rotating disc that stores rotational energy. Its primary functions include protecting the flywheel, providing a mounting point, and ensuring the flywheel operates within correct parameters. It integrates with components like the clutch assembly and engine block, contributing to smooth engine operation 1.

Role of 3106208 Flywheel Housing in Engine Systems

The flywheel housing, identified by part number 3106208, is an integral component in the assembly and operation of engine systems. It serves as the protective enclosure for the flywheel, which is a key element in the engine’s rotational energy storage and transfer mechanism.

Integration with Key Engine Components

  1. Flywheel: The primary role of the flywheel housing is to encase the flywheel, safeguarding it from external elements and ensuring its smooth operation. The flywheel helps in maintaining the engine’s momentum between power strokes, contributing to a consistent rotational speed.

  2. Clutch Assembly: In manual transmission systems, the flywheel housing interfaces with the clutch assembly. This interaction is vital for the smooth engagement and disengagement of the clutch, which is essential for gear changes.

  3. Torque Converter (Automatic Transmissions): In automatic transmissions, the flywheel housing works in conjunction with the torque converter. The torque converter uses the flywheel’s rotational energy to transmit power to the transmission, allowing for seamless gear shifts.

  4. Engine Block: The flywheel housing is typically bolted to the engine block. This secure attachment ensures that the housing remains stable and aligned with the crankshaft, which is connected to the flywheel.

  5. Starter Motor: During engine start-up, the starter motor engages with the flywheel, which is housed within the flywheel housing. This engagement is necessary to initiate the engine’s rotation and start the combustion process.

  6. Vibration Dampening: The flywheel housing also plays a role in reducing vibrations produced by the engine. By encasing the flywheel, it helps in absorbing and dissipating some of the vibrations, contributing to a smoother engine operation.

  7. Alignment with Transmission: Proper alignment of the flywheel housing with the transmission is essential for efficient power transfer. Misalignment can lead to increased wear and potential failure of transmission components.
